How to write the inverse of 3x+4y=12 in f^-1 (x)?
1 answer:
3x+4y=12
4y=12-3x
y=(12-3x)/4 <---------- This is f(x)
---------------------
3x+4y=12
3x=12-4y
x=(12-4y)/3
Therefore:
f⁻¹(x)=(12-4x)/3
=[4(3-x)]/3
